Among the options for the most relevant fabric for sewing covers, the following can be noted:

    Cotton. Inexpensive and hypoallergenic cotton fabrics are durable and wash well. The disadvantages include instant wetness. The colors on these materials fade quickly in the sun.

    linen fabrics extremely resistant, suitable for many years of use without loss of quality. Linen products will always be relevant for kitchen interiors. different styles, especially for rustic country and gentle Provence. A slightly rough texture is difficult to color, hard to wash and iron.

    Crepe satin and gabardine- the most successful materials for chair covers. Elegant fabric variations that provide sophisticated appearance future products, have good elasticity and density, are easy to wash and clean.

    supplex/lycra- elastic fabrics that stretch perfectly in all directions. By the combination of qualities, they are suitable for any furniture covers: resistant, waterproof, easy to clean.

How to take measurements and make a pattern?

initial stage sewing a cover is the creation of a pattern. It completely depends on the design of the furniture product.

It is necessary to take a material that takes shape well and put it over a chair, fixing it with pins in the right places. At this stage, you need to decide what the cover will be like, how much the legs will be covered, whether a fastener is needed at the back.

Measurements for the cover can be taken using tracing paper. Let's give an example for a simple product with a back and a pleat at the back.

A layer of paper is applied to the seat, fixed with tailor's needles and circled around the contour. Add 1.5 cm for an allowance on all sides and cut out the part. Measure the back of the chair in the same way.

For the front of the “skirt” of the cover, measure the length of the legs of the chair and the width of the front edge. A rectangle is drawn on a sheet of tracing paper and 5 cm are added from the bottom of the pattern and 10 cm each on the sides, plus a 1.5 cm seam allowance along the upper edge.

Similarly, they make a pattern for the sidewalls of the "skirt". 15 cm are added to the edge adjacent to the outer part of the back. The pattern is made in duplicate.

For measurements of the outer part of the back, a long sheet of tracing paper is applied to the upper edge of the back of the chair, the outer edges are marked. Draw lines along the back legs of the chair to the floor, add 5 cm from the bottom and 1.5 cm for the allowance. The centers are marked at the bottom and top of the patterns, then they are folded along them and the canvas is cut into two even parts.

The simpler the product, the fewer measurements are needed. For a simple seat, you only need to measure the depth and width of the seat.

Sewing of universal products

The manufacture of universal models does not involve a complex pattern, taking measurements and creating a template on paper is carried out according to the standard scheme.

Consider sewing a cover using the example of a product with a back and a fold at the back in stages:

  1. The pattern is transferred to the fabric, always taking into account the position of the shared thread. You can draw on fabric with chalk, a thin bar of soap or a pencil.
  2. After cutting, they move on to tailoring the product. First grind the side seams of the back.
  3. Next, we tuck and sheathe the lower and side sections of the back of the back.
  4. At this stage, you can sew the zipper into the pleat at the back of the product. After that, we grind the upper edge of the back of the chair.
  5. We sew together all the parts of the "skirt". We tuck its bottom edge and sew it.
  6. We grind the seat of the cover and the upper edge of the "skirt".
  7. We connect the back and the rest of the parts together.
  8. At the final stage, you need to overlay the internal seams and sections. If this is not possible, you can do it manually with an overcast seam.
  9. If the zipper was not sewn in, you need to sew decorative loops and buttons into the fold at the back of the product.

3. How to take measurements for a chair cover

The pattern of the chair cover will be the more accurate, the more accurately you take measurements. Particular attention should be paid to the legs, as they usually have an extension to the bottom, sometimes only the rear legs and only to one side. So take as many measurements of the chair as you can and draw a diagram of your measurements before you start building the cover pattern. Determine the widest and narrowest sections and mark them on the drawing. Make a copy of the seat and back on paper by tracing the outline with a pencil, attaching the paper to these parts of the chair. Then cut scissors and adjust the pattern, applying it to check exactly on the back and seat. Make a markup on the resulting patterns and take them as the basis for building a further pattern. The rest of the details will have to be done using calculations.

All dimensions indicated on the drawing of the chair are conditional and are given only as an example, which measurements must be taken.

4. Before you buy a fabric, calculate its consumption

When the patterns of the details of the cover are ready, you need to make a layout of the fabric and calculate it consumption. When sewing chair covers, there is always a feeling that a little fabric is needed, a kind of visual deception. In fact, fabrics 150 cm wide, for any chair with a cover that has a skirt, 130 - 150 cm are required. Sometimes, depending on the length of the skirt and other decorative elements, such as pleats along the skirt, you need to buy up to 2 x meters of fabric.

Calculate, before you buy furniture fabric, exactly how much fabric you need. It is necessary to take into account allowances for seams, for hem hem, inaccuracy of cut. Do not forget to think about how you will take into account the width of the back and the "flare" of the legs when cutting the details. The simplest solution is to make an insert the width of the back of the chair, up to the sewing line of the skirt, and to expand the legs downwards, add a wedge along the edges of the skirt. Usually, the fabric consumption for a standard size chair fits one and a half meters. In this example, we fit the front and back parts in the same width and made the height of the skirt from the remaining strip of fabric 25 cm, plus 5 cm for the hem and the seam. It is desirable to place parts along the share thread, as shown in the diagram.

5. Make Trial Cases with Inexpensive Fabric First

It is very difficult, without experience, to make an accurate pattern for covers - anyway, something will be wrong. There are so many models of chairs and options for their manufacture that it is simply impossible to give a ready-made pattern for sewing chair covers. A pattern for a different shape and size of a chair is made on its own. One can only advise, before cutting the fabric purchased for covers, first sew "trial" covers, for example, from an old sheet or inexpensive fabric. Try on several times, and in the process of trying on, make adjustments, sometimes even opening the cover for this. And only after you achieve an exact copy of the shape of your chair, cut out the final version of the details of the covers on the fabric purchased for them.

6. To prevent the covers from slipping, they need to be fixed to the legs of the chair

When sewing covers, or rather, before cutting, think about how the covers will be attached to the chair. Even if the cover is worn entirely, almost to the floor, it will still "move out" while sitting and wrinkle. It is necessary to sew on the mount, in the form of ties at the corners and tie them to the legs under the cover. If the back and seat are sewn separately, then it is necessary to foresee how they will be attached to the chair. The best option- make a hem along the edges, where to insert an elastic band or a cord that can be tightened and tied (take into account the hem when cutting). This will securely fix the seat, and it will not slip and wrinkle.

7. Do not sew covers from too expensive fabrics

Some practical advice- do not sew from too expensive fabrics, otherwise you will have to sew covers on them later.

And yet, never sew covers "back to back" - chairs are not a pillow, and if the cover is at least a little narrow somewhere, it simply won't fit. The stock never hurts, and you can always remove it, besides, some fabrics may “shrink” after washing.

Cover pattern for a chair with a square back

The easiest way is to sew a chair cover with a square back, more difficult with a rounded one, but more on that later. It is advisable to make a one-piece pattern, but if this is not possible, then sew from separate parts. Separate parts can be sewn on the chair itself by attaching the fabric with the right side to the chair. Then sew everything on sewing machine, turn out on front side and put on a chair.

In the figure below, the numbers indicate the parts that need to be cut out.

For parts No. 1,2 and 3, add 2.5 cm for allowances, and for parts No. 4, 5 and 6 - 2 cm for allowances on top and sides and 3 cm for allowance for the bottom edge. The sixth part must be folded in half in width and measure the middle of the back of the chair and add 9 cm to it. For a chair cover, one part No. 1, 2 and 5 and two parts No. 3, 4 and 6 are required.

After cutting, we begin work with the sixth part. We tuck 1.5 cm, and then another 5 and sew on a typewriter. Next, add the hemmed elements together and make a mark on the upper cut, as shown in the picture below.

Then we cut off the top of part 1 and the cut and grind them with their front sides. Do not forget about the allowance of 1.5 cm. We also grind parts 1 and 2. After we put the resulting part on the chair with the wrong side up, pin the side parts No. 3. It makes sense to sweep them right on the chair, then remove the future cover from the furniture and grind the elements along estimate. Then the part must be ironed.

With an allowance of 1.5 cm, we grind part 4 with short cuts of part No. 5. Next, we cut off the resulting frill with a side cut of one wedge, 3 sides of the seat and a side cut of the second wedge facing each other. With an allowance of 1.5 cm, we grind the resulting seams. We turn the cover on the front side, straighten the corners and iron.
